Venture Through Asia
Immerse yourself in the delights of Asia in the springtime on this 17-night voyage. Embark in exciting Tokyo, and witness the frenetic energy of Shibuya Crossing or sample the freshest sushi imaginable at Tsukiji Market. After an enjoyable day at sea, arrive in bustling Osaka, where with a late night visit you can visit the ornate Osaka Castle and feast on local street food like okonomiyaki (savory cabbage-filled pancakes) and takoyaki (fried balls of dough made with octopus). No trip to Kochi is complete without a stop at Kochi Castle, one of the few original castles left in the country.
An overnight stay in Kagoshima gives you a glimpse into “old Japan”, with a street home to perfectly preserved Samurai houses. In the distance you’ll find the active volcano Sakurajima, which provides the surrounding area with plenty of geothermal pools to relax in.
Depart from Japan and spend another relaxing day at sea before arriving in Taipei where a late night departure gives you plenty of time to soak up the sights, sounds, and flavors of the city. Partake in the ship’s numerous onboard activities on a day at sea before an overnight stay in Hong Kong. Take the tram up to Victoria Peak for views that will take your breath away. People watch as you travel along the Mid-Level escalators, or take the Star Ferry across the harbor and shop Kowloon’s bustling night markets.
Another sea day will make sure you’re well rested, and set to enjoy the splendors of Da Nang Vietnam and travel to Hue. Set on the Perfume River, Hue is a sprawling imperial city packed with temples, museums, and galleries. Enjoy a day sailing the South China Sea before an overnight visit in Ho Chi Minh City, a port that’s full of busy marketplaces and delicious food vendors (Bahn Mi and Vietnamese Coffee are must-trys). Visit the Reunification Palace or the Cu Chi Tunnels on the Mekong Delta. Use your last day at sea to experience any of the Azamara Quest’s amenities you may have missed, before debarking in Singapore. Often nicknamed Little Red Dot due to its small size, Singapore is big on flavor, and home to sprawling Hawker Stalls, filled with delicious cuisine, each stall usually specializes in one or two dishes.
